Official DOL plan name: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an · Sponsored by Wrmc Hospital Operating Corporation · North Carolina · Healthcare & Social Assistance

$28M in assets, 194 participants

Wrmc Hospital Operating Corporation's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an reported $28M in total assets and 194 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 76th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ings

plan year 2023 → plan year 2024

  •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an reported net income fell from $3M in the plan year 2023 filing to -$969K in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an reported participants fell from 200 in the plan year 2023 filing to 194 in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an end-of-year assets fell from $29M in the plan year 2023 filing to $28M in the plan year 2024 filing.

Frequently Asked Questions

How did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an assets move in 2024?
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an edged down modestly - down 2.9% during 2024, from $29M to $28M. Reported net income was -$969K.
How have Wrmc Hospital Operating Corporation plan assets changed over time?
Across 3 plan years on file (2022-2024), Wrmc Hospital Operating Corporation's sponsor-wide assets grew 8.8%, from $26M to $28M.
Where does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an rank by assets among Form 5500 filers?
Wilkes Regional Medical Center Employees' Pension Plan ranks in the 76th percentile by end-of-year assets among 123,622 plans that reported assets for plan year 2024 (in the top quartile of all filed plans by assets).
